Piercefield House near St Arvans, Monmouthshire, Wales, about 1.5 miles (2.4 km) north of the centre of Chepstow, is a largely ruined neo-classical country house.The central block of the house was designed in the very late 18th century, by, or to the designs of, Sir John Soane.It is flanked by two pavilions, of slightly later date, by Joseph Bonomi the Elder.
